Dhotra Village

Dhotra is an inhabited village in Teosa Taluka of Amravati district, Maharashtra. Its Census village code is 532564, the Census 2011 record lists 878 people in 240 households and the reported area is 761.44 hectares. The local references include Teosa CD Block and the nearest town reference is Amravati at about 25 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 878 people in 240 households, with 459 male residents and 419 female residents. The average household size is 3.66, and SC share is 26.77% and ST share is 0.8% for Dhotra. Population density works out to about 115.31 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Dhotra show that net sown area is 560.5 hectares and irrigated land is 535.7 hectares (95.6%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
